Demographic insights for Birmingham 123
The population of Birmingham 123 is on average 38 years old with men making up 48% and females making up 52% of the entire local residental population
Birmingham 123 residents are mostly Straight or Heterosexual (87.6%) with the majority being Never married and never registered a civil partnership (46.6%)
Residents of Birmingham 123 that are classed as students account for 21.69% of the population, 1.27% above the overall national average. Of those that are not currently studying, 68% have 5+ GCSE/O-levels which is 4.00% below the overall national average.
88% of the local population were born in the UK and 92% have lived in Birmingham 123 for 3 years or more.
